Discussion - 3.2

The bar code is an important tool for inventory managers. It uniquely identifies an inventory item, making cycle counting, work-in-process inventory management and sales inventory management more efficient. Bar codes will be replaced by a new way of identifying items: Radio Frequency Identification (RFID). Do some exploratory research of RFID on the Internet and then use your knowledge to state your opinion on the question shown in the discussion topic's title. Many business groups have stated that there is no need for privacy regulations in the area of RFID. Do you agree? Why or why not?

RFID devices are microchips with antennas embedded in items (finished products and also sub-assemblies) that transmit information about the item. A scanner can pick up this information from as far as 750 centimeters or 25 feet away. These devices do not disable themselves after the item leaves the factory or even the outlet where it was purchased.
